Subject: Cut-over summary — Pixelhoard image cache

Team: cut-over to the rebuilt Pixelhoard cache completed Tuesday night. The leak traced to evicted thumbnails never releasing decoder buffers; new pool-based allocator fixes it. Heap is flat after 48h under production load on the Ostermere cluster. Old nodes drain Friday. For the sync, the settings we went live with are below.

config for kagup-hahig:
druwyn:
  pin: 2801
  metrics_host: metrics.druwyn.zemvarlabs.internal
  tenant: sorius
  seal: seal_798a43d7

Bike cage and parking gates — Quillstone Park site. Contractors arriving by bicycle should use the cage at the rear of Building C; cars enter via the north gates off the service road. Gates open automatically on exit but require a code on entry between 06:00 and 20:00. Outside those hours, call the duty officer from the intercom. Do not share the code with delivery drivers. The current entry code is shown below.

turnstile pass: bdg-FVNQRS-72965873

Subject: Q2 Cash-Flow Forecast — Branch Managers

All, the Q2 forecast is final. Net inflows down 3% versus Q1, driven by slower receivables at the Dunhaven and Storlake branches. Payables schedule unchanged. Branch managers: submit updated collection plans by the 15th. No discretionary spend above approved limits until further notice. Questions to Farrow in treasury. A confidential note on forward plans follows directly below.

board note of hahaf-fahog: The pricing group signed off on a budget of $229.3 million for Project Aldius.

Hey Marisol — handing off Lattice UI Kit before I'm out next week. We bumped to 4.2.0 after the button refactor, so downstream teams at Quellhaven need the changelog pinged. Please don't cut 4.3 until the tokens package syncs; otherwise the theming breaks in Driftboard. Publishing creds live in the shared vault, which got re-keyed Tuesday. You'll need the recovery passphrase to unlock it, which is:

vault phrase of kawep-tahog = ulaix-briath